Deputy City Manager Wayne Hobbs informed the City Council that the corrective repairs to the back section of the Maple Avenue parking lot had been completed and approved by the structural engineer. Certain issues arose regarding the front section of the lot; however, a solution had been identified. Work on the front section of the lot was expected to be completed on or around June 16th.
The Deputy City Manager advised the City Council that the fire inspection for Phase Two of the Community Center project was scheduled to take place on June 6th. Once the City had received a favorable fire inspection, TRG Construction would call for the building inspection, which was the final step in obtaining occupancy.
Deputy City Manager Hobbs updated the City Council on the geotechnical study for the proposed gymnasium construction. Completion of the study had been delayed due to staff turnover at the firm performing the study. The City expected to receive the final report in approximately two weeks.
